Been a while since Ive posted anything surf fishing related so I figured id give a quick report. Surf fishing has been decent and should only get better. Lots of bait in the water right now. Been fishing quite a bit lately and have caught numerous bull reds, sharks and stingray. Ive got 3 surf rods that I deploy. I stagger them when I cast to try to see where the fish are holding. After I catch one then Ill move the other lines accordingly. Ive talked to several people on the beach who said they didnt catch anything. When asked what type of bait they used, they replied with mullet. Ive had several trips where I couldnt get bit on mullet but as soon as I changed to croaker, whiting or sand trout, I started catching. So dont get hung up on one bait or one location.
